CHRISTMAS CHARITY LUNCH & MOVIE DAY-OUT
In the spirit of giving during Christmas Season, 20 children & their caretakers from City Revival Community Service Berhad were invited to Summit Hotel Subang USJ for a lunch treat at Oceania Buffet Restaurant on 16th December 2011. This event is hosted by Summit Hotel Subang USJ &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el to celebrate those less fortunate on the festive season. Both hotel management & JCC members sang Christmas Carols to entertain the children and one of the hotel’s staff perform Magic Show tricks. The highlight of the day was Movie Time at Golden Screen Cinema, Summit Complex. They enjoy watching Happy Feet 2, adorable penguins that can sing and dance. Before sending off the children, each of them received cash packet and a special goodie bag with their name attached on it and sundries for the homes.
Deepavali Charity Celebration
In conjunction with Deepavali, The Festival of Light, Summit Hotel Subang USJ &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el brought a ray of lights and happiness to some 20 children from Rumah K.I.D.S and also children from single mothers in USJ 1 on 29 October 2011.
Their day started with a dip in the hotel's pool on a bright sunny day. The children were so excited and happy frolicking in the pool that their caretakers had a hard time getting them out. They also have fun learning how to make bed during the bed making demonstration by the housekeeping staff while on hotel tour.
The children then treated to a scrumptious buffet high-tea of Traditional Indian dishes, cakes & sweets. But the hit among the kids were ice-cream that they continuously going for more. One of the hotel's staff entertained the children with Magic Show. They were so thrilled and able to learn some tricks that they keep asking for more.
This charity programme is part of Summit Hotels & Resorts Group's commitment towards the less fortunate community. Present at the event was Mr. Lam Hin Choon, Group General Manager for Summit Hotels & Resorts, Mr. Muhaiyuddin Ahmad Group Director of Operation and Mr. Anthony Wee, Hotel Manager for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el accompanied by the Heads of Department.
Before sending off the children, each received a cash packet and a goodie bag. It's a wonderful feeling seeing smiles on their faces as they thanked the hotel's staff before leaving.
SUMMIT HOTEL SUBANG USJ NAMED OFFICIAL HOTEL PARTNER FOR MAGIC MIRROR THE MUSICAL 2011
Summit Hotel Subang USJ will be the official hotel partner for the "Magic Mirror The Musical 2011" organized by Yayasan Guan Yin to be staged at Istana Budaya, Kuala Lumpur from 25th November 2011 to the 5th December 2011.
Endorsed by Tourism Ministry, Magic Mirror The Musical, is a stunningly colorful, and captivating musical stage performance combining artistes and talents both from Malaysia and China. The Musical which is about love and compassion is based on the story of Guan Yin in the Tang Dynasty. The aim of the musical is to raise fund for the foundation's various welfare and charity activities.

Bubur Lambuk treats to the community
Summit Hotel Subang USJ embraces the spirit of the Ramadan with distribution of bubur lambuk to the public in Subang USJ on 12 & 19 August 2011 at the hotel's open-air car park.
This annual charity project held by the hotel during the fasting month was part of the activities to mark Ramadan and aimed to strengthening closeness with the local community in the spirit of giving and living in a responsible and receptive society.
Members of the public were informed of distribution of the ever popular dish for Ramadhan through banner at the distribution area prior to the dates.
This program involved both Muslims and non-Muslim staff to enhance the spirit of togetherness among hotel's staff. The team led by Executive Chef Faizal started cooking the bubur lambuk from 12 noon in order to be ready for distribution at 4.00pm.
On 13th August 2011, in conjunction of Kempen Balik Kampung - Rumah Selamat crime-prevention programme launching ceremony, the hotel also contributes 200 packets of bubur lambuk to Ibu Pejabat Polis Daerah Subang Jaya.
Majlis Amal Berbuka Puasa Summit Hotel Subang USJ &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el
Eighty-five children ranging age from 6 months to 17 years old from Rumah Amal Limpahan Kasih, a home for the less privileged based in Puchong were invited to Summit Hotel Subang USJ on 3rd August 2011 for a breaking fast dinner treat at Oceania Buffet Restaurant. This event is hosted by Summit Hotel Subang USJ &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el for the less fortunate on this holy month. The children were entertained by Ghazal performance from Kumpulan Budaya Suara Klasik "Samsudin Lamin" having special appearance throughout fasting month at Oceania Buffet Restaurant. The children responded by giving a special performance and dedicated songs as a token of appreciation to the hotel management. They were welcomed and attended by Summit Hotels & Resorts Group General Manager, Mr. Lam Hin Choon, Group Director of Operation Mr. Muhaiyuddin,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el Residence Manager Mr. Anthony Wee, heads of departments and staff. The hotels presented the children with 'Duit Raya' and sundry goods and some cash for the home in addition to the scrumptious dinner.

Lion Dance & Acrobatic Performance Welcoming Rabbit Year
To usher in the Year of Rabbit, Summit Hotel Subang USJ invited a lion dance troupe to bless the hotel as well as treat its guest to a live show on 10th February 2011. Moving to the loud sound of cymbals, drums and gongs, the lions danced and pranced in sync with the music, mesmerizing the audience. Lion dance performance was an annual affair at Summit Hotel Subang USJ.
Before the main event, the agile lions usher in good luck and prosperity by going around the lobby and other parts of the hotel. They presented the hotel's Group Director of Operation, Mr. Muhaiyuddin with a platter of lettuce leaves, pomelo and Mandarin oranges.
Visitors who had gathered to catch the lion dance performance also received Mandarin oranges.
Chinese New Year Charity Chinese New Year Charity Visit - Rumah Charis
On 29 January 2011, The Summit Hotel Subang USJ & Peninsula Residence All Suite Hotel brought cheer to senior citizens at Rumah Charis in conjunction with the Chinese New Year.
As many elderly folks in nursing homes do not get the opportunity to celebrate with their families during this festive season, the hotel's management took the initiative to show their appreciation and respect towards the elderly community by hosting hi-tea and share the joy with them.
Twenty volunteers from both hotels treated the elderly residents to a sumptuous meal & Yee Sang tossing ceremony. The residents were each presented with 'Ang Pow' and sundry goods for the home.
